Claude is the CEO of , the largest truckload freight marketplace in North America. getty Both spot and contract freight shipping rates have across the board, even as inflation has climbed in other industries. That’s because the trucking industry (particularly its truckload sector) is subject to its own two- to three-year , alternating between periods of inflation and deflation.
